CHICAGO – A 16-year-old boy was injured in a drive-by shooting Sunday night in the Gage Park neighborhood on Chicago’s Southwest Side.
What we know:
The shooting happened around 9:50 p.m. in the 2300 block of West 50th Street, according to Chicago police.…
